Overview of Riverview Correctional Facility

Riverview Correctional Facility is a medium-security state prison located in Ogdensburg, New York, part of St. Lawrence County. It primarily houses male inmates and is operated by the New York State Department of Corrections and Community Supervision (DOCCS).

How to Locate an Inmate

To locate an inmate at Riverview Correctional Facility, use the New York State Department of Corrections and Community Supervision Inmate Lookup service. You will need the inmate's name or Department Identification Number (DIN).

Phone Calls and Video Options

Inmates at Riverview Correctional Facility are allowed to make outgoing calls but cannot receive incoming calls. Alternatively, video visitation is available via JPay. Friends and family can set up video visitation sessions through the JPay website.
